Design and Realization of a Flat Surface Cleaning Robot

Article Preview

Abstract:

Through the analysis of the glass wall and solar panel cleaning robot research status at home and abroad, based on cleaning characteristics and requirements of such kind of smooth surface, a full pneumatic-driven flat surface cleaning robot system is presented. The robot adopts unique three-position cylinder driving technique, SCM and PC two-level control, can crawl along the smooth surface and clean, and can overcome obstacles in a certain height. Running results show that the robot system has simple structure, low cost, the functions of on-line fault diagnosis, and can provide a new efficient, simple and safe way for the glass wall and solar panel cleaning.
